在IT行业中,简历(cv)是求职者向潜在雇主展示自己技能、经验和技术能力的重要工具。HTML(HyperText Markup Language)是一种广泛用于创建网页的标准标记语言,它在制作电子简历时发挥着关键作用。利用HTML编写简历,可以使得简历具有跨平台的可读性,并能轻松地进行格式调整和个性化设计。
1. HTML基础结构:一个基本的HTML简历应该包含`<!DOCTYPE html>`声明,定义文档类型为HTML5;`<html>`元素作为整个文档的根元素;`<head>`元素内包含元信息,如字符编码(`<meta charset="UTF-8">`)和页面标题(`<title>`);以及`<body>`元素,包含实际的简历内容。
2. 布局与样式:HTML简历可以利用`<div>`元素来划分不同部分,如个人信息、教育背景、工作经验和技能等。通过CSS(Cascading Style Sheets)可以实现更精细的布局控制,如浮动(`float`)、定位(`position`)和响应式设计(媒体查询`@media query`),确保简历在不同设备上都能良好显示。
3. 标题和段落:`<h1>`到`<h6>`用于设定各级标题,简历通常用`<h1>`表示求职者的姓名。`<p>`元素用于描述各项内容,如职位描述或项目详情。
4. 列表:`<ul>`和`<ol>`元素分别用于无序列表和有序列表,适合展示技能列表、项目经验或证书等。
5. 表格:虽然不常用,但`<table>`、`<tr>`、`<td>`等元素可用于呈现结构化的信息,如工作经历的日期和职责。
6. 链接:`<a>`元素可链接到在线作品集、社交媒体账号或其他相关资源,增加简历的互动性。
7. 图像:`<img>`元素插入个人照片,需指定`src`属性指向图片URL,同时设置`alt`属性提供文本描述。
8. 样式优化:可以使用内联样式(在元素内添加`style`属性),内部样式表(`<style>`标签内),或外部样式表(`.css`文件)来管理样式。为了提高可维护性和重用性,推荐使用外部样式表。
9. 交互元素:HTML5引入了许多新的表单控件,如`<input type="date">`、`<textarea>`,可以用于收集求职者的信息,但不常见于静态简历。
10. 跨浏览器兼容性:确保HTML简历在主流浏览器(如Chrome、Firefox、Safari、Edge)上表现一致,可能需要对CSS和HTML进行适当的调整和测试。
11. 一个优秀的HTML简历不仅应具备良好的视觉设计,还要清晰、简洁地传达求职者的技能和成就,吸引招聘者的注意力。在发布简历时,可以选择将其保存为`.html`文件,或者转换成PDF以保持格式稳定。